Bio

Rea Schenk (* 1969, Berlin) lives and works in Berlin. After graduating with a degree in Energy and Supply Engineering (Diplom-Ingenieur), she worked in the technical sector for many years and subsequently as a freelance designer and computer graphics artist. Since 2023, she has increasingly shifted her focus toward the artistic field. Her works combine photographic source material with digital interventions that are strongly influenced by her technical background. In her current work, she explores perception as an open-ended process, developing pictorial spaces that elude definitive classification. Her pieces have been exhibited in Berlin and London, among other locations, and are held in private collections.
